NAME

Test::Skip::UnlessExistsExecutable - skips tests unless executable exists

SYNOPSIS

    use Test::More tests => 1;
    use Test::Skip::UnlessExistsExecutable qw(
        /usr/bin/rsync
        perl
    );
    use_ok 'Mouse';

    # or

    use Test::More tests => 1;
    use Test::Skip::UnlessExistsExecutable; 

    skip_all_unless_exists '/bin/sh';
    skip_all_unless_exists 'perl';
    ok 1;

DESCRIPTION

Test::Skip::UnlessExistsExecutable checks if an executable exist and skips the test if it does not. The intent is to avoid needing to write this sort of boilerplate code:

    Test::More;
    BEGIN {
        do_i_have_all_my_optional_deps() ? plan skip_all : plan tests => 42
    }

INTERFACE

Both Test::Skip::UnlessExistsExecutable import method and test_exists_executable method take the name of a program or the file path of executable. It checks if the program exists and is executable.
